Buccaneers sign DT Black, CB Gaitor

The Tampa Bay Buccaneers signed defensive tackle Jibreel Black and cornerback Anthony Gaitor on Monday.

Black, who was not drafted, played collegiately at Michigan.

Gaitor has played 12 games in three seasons with the Buccaneers since they selected him in the seventh round of the 2011 draft. He has 10 career tackles and four pass breakups.

The team also waived running back Brendan Bigelow and wide receiver Quintin Payton.
